The 1550 nm setting also helps tighten aging skin and addresses a wide variety of changes in your skin’s feel and texture, including wrinkles, enlarged pores, and scarring from acne or injury.The 1927 nm setting can be used effectively to treat pigment problems like freckles, melasma/chloasma, age spots, and sun damage.This gentle resurfacing laser has two separate settings: 1550nm and 1927nm. These heat zones help your skin produce collagen for up to 6 months after each procedure, making your skin look younger, smoother, and firmer. DeepFX is a deeper treatment than can treat deeper wrinkles, scars, and provide skin tightening. When areas of normal skin are left behind, the skin heals much faster than with the traditional CO2 devices.ĪctiveFX is a more superficial treatment that is excellent for skin pigmentation and fine lines. Fractionated means that little holes are created in the skin while protecting some areas of normal skin. Many lasers work by wounding (or "ablating") layers of your skin so new, healthier layers can grow in. The Lumenis Active and Deep Fx use a fractionated ablative delivery system that allows for faster recovery than the traditional Co2 lasers with fewer side effects. It can also effectively treat surgical and acne scars. Few other lasers on the market can take five years off of your wrinkles. Specialists use this laser to treat signs of skin aging caused by sun exposure and other environmental factors. CO2 Laser resurfacing is considered the gold standard for total skin rejuvenation for a more youthful appearance.
